  2. Iowa:
    "Renewables now account for roughly 62% of Iowa’s electricity generation, up from 18% in 2010, with wind alone providing nearly 59% of total output.

    The report found notable disparities in property tax burdens based on proximity to wind development. Properties in school districts with no wind turbines pay 26% higher property taxes on average than those in districts with large-scale wind production."

  3. This is one of my favorite spots along the Liesing in Vienna.

    I don't know about this section, but most of the Lising was confined in concrete walls not too many years ago, but almost every section in Vienna has been renaturalized by now.

    The results:
    * fewer floods
    * better water quality (Platon doesn't stink after bathing)
    * the human psyche benefits from the beauty of nature
    * more biodiversity
    * great education opportunity (you probably can't see it in the pictures, but just a little bit upstream there is a group of kindergardeners probably learning something about the environment)
    * cooler microclimate
    * and many, many more

  6. "Our study is the first detailed national evaluation of the health effects of the CCC’s decarbonisation pathways. We show that net-zero is likely to lead to substantial benefits for public health – and that these benefits are greater with faster and more ambitious change."

    Improving home #energy #efficiency gives biggest bang for the - um - pound.
